As an Idol, As AKB48 - The Place where Okabe Rin and Kuranoo Narumi Stand
The documentary follows Okabe Rin and Kuranoo Narumi, two members of Team 8, as they rise into the competitive battlefield of AKB48's Senbatsu for the first times. It's a great look into what it means to rank in to the Senbatsu through the elections versus being hand picked for a Senbatsu, as well as into these two individual members themselves!

📋 Film Details
| Original Title | アイドルとしてAKB48として ~岡部 麟・倉野尾成美が立っている場所~ |
| Year | 2018 |
| Country | Japan |
| Genre | Documentary, Music |
| Director | Eiki Takahashi |
| Runtime | 66 min. |
